Islam Karimov charity foundation established in Uzbekistan

By Trend
The charity foundation named after Uzbek first President Islam Karimov has been established in Uzbekistan, Karimov’s youngest daughter Lola Karimova-Tillyaeva, said.
Karimova-Tillyaeva said that among the main objectives of the fund are to popularize the historical, cultural and literary heritage of Uzbekistan within the country and abroad and implement scientific-educational and cultural programs for training and developing young people's potential.
"According to the above-mentioned objectives, the fund will issue grants to the gifted young people to study at the best domestic and foreign universities,” she added.
She stressed that the fund will pay special attention to the development of the Uzbek language.
"I hope that the activity of the fund will help our citizens to implement their potential and support the rich cultural life of the country,” Karimova-Tillyaeva said.
